Q
Is Xpander 2024 3 cylinder?
Based on the current information, the 2024 Mitsubishi Xpander available in the Malaysian market is equipped with a 1.5 - liter MIVEC four - cylinder naturally aspirated engine, not a three - cylinder configuration. This engine delivers 105 horsepower and 141 Nm of torque, paired with either a 5 - speed manual or a 4 - speed automatic transmission. It focuses on providing smoothness and fuel efficiency for the family car market. The doubts about a three - cylinder engine might stem from the fact that some brands have adopted three - cylinder technology in recent years for emission reduction purposes. However, the Xpander maintains a four - cylinder layout to ensure power stability. Q
What is the ground clearance of the Xpander 2024?
The 2024 Mitsubishi Xpander has a ground clearance of 205 millimeters. This figure is relatively high among compact MPVs and allows the vehicle to adapt well to Malaysia's diverse road conditions, including urban roads and the rough terrains in the suburbs. The high ground clearance not only improves the vehicle's passability but also reduces the risk of chassis scratches, especially on flooded roads that may occur during the rainy season in Malaysia. Q
How to open the hood of Xpander 2024?
To open the hood of the 2024 Mitsubishi Xpander, first, sit in the driver's seat. Locate a handle with a hood icon near the driver's side foot area. Usually, it's located at the lower - left of the steering wheel or on the side of the dashboard. Pull this handle firmly, and you'll hear the sound of the first hood lock releasing. Then, walk to the front of the vehicle, reach your hand into the gap in the center of the front edge of the hood, and you can feel a lever for the secondary safety lock. Push the lever to the right and gently lift the hood to fully open it. It's recommended to ensure the vehicle is turned off and parked on a flat surface during the operation for safety. It's worth noting that the hood opening methods of Xpander models from different years may vary slightly. The 2024 model uses a double - lock mechanism to prevent the hood from popping open accidentally while driving, which is also the standard safety design for most new cars nowadays. If you have difficulty opening the hood, don't force it. Check if both locks are fully released. Regularly applying lubricant to the lock parts can also keep the mechanism running smoothly. Q
Is the Xpander 2024 a hybrid?
The 20204 Xpander is available in a hybrid version. Its gasoline - electric hybrid system consists of a 1.6L four - cylinder naturally aspirated gasoline engine with the code 4A92 paired with an electric motor. The engine has 95 horsepower and 134 Nm of torque. After being paired with the motor, the combined horsepower output reaches 116, and the combined torque is 255 Nm. The transmission system is mated to an e - CVT electronic continuously variable automatic transmission, and it adopts front - wheel drive. Compared with the regular gasoline version, the hybrid version has some additional blue trim strips on the front bumper and features different two - tone wheels. The rear - wheel braking system has been upgraded from drum brakes to disc brakes. It also offers new suspension tuning, an active cornering control system, and a seven - mode driving selection system. In terms of the interior, it comes with a newly - designed steering wheel. The instrument panel has been upgraded to an 8 - inch LCD screen, and the shift lever and driving - mode selection lever also feature brand - new designs, which can bring a different driving and riding experience.

Q
How much is Mitsubishi Xpander Malaysia 2024?
The 2024 Mitsubishi Xpander is available in two models in Malaysia. The Xpander is priced at RM 99,980, and the Xpander Plus is priced at RM 109,980 (the above prices are excluding insurance). This 7-seater MPV not only has an upgraded exterior but also an improved interior configuration. It's equipped with a 1.5-liter MIVEC naturally aspirated engine, which emphasizes reliability and fuel economy, with a fuel consumption of about 7.5L per 100 kilometers, making it suitable for daily city commuting and family trips. It has a length of 4,595mm, a width of 1,750mm, a height of 1,750mm, a wheelbase of 2,775mm, and a ground clearance of 205mm, enabling it to perform well on different road conditions. As the high - end version, the Xpander Plus comes with additional features such as leather seats, a wireless phone charging panel, a 360° panoramic camera, and front and rear dash cams.

Q
What size engine is in the Volvo XC90 T5?
The Volvo XC90 T5 is equipped with a 2.0-liter four-cylinder turbocharged gasoline engine. This engine belongs to the Volvo Drive-E series, with a maximum output power of 250 horsepower and a peak torque of 350 Nm. It is paired with an 8-speed automatic transmission, offering a smooth and efficient driving experience. For Malaysian consumers, this engine combines good power performance with excellent fuel economy, making it suitable for both city driving and long-distance travel. It's worth mentioning that the Drive-E engine series from Volvo features a modular design, which not only reduces weight but also optimizes emission performance, meeting the increasingly strict global environmental standards. Q
What engine is in the Volvo XC90 T5 2020?
The 2020 Volvo XC90 T5 is equipped with a 2.0-liter four-cylinder turbocharged gasoline engine. The maximum output power reaches 250 horsepower, and the peak torque hits 350 Nm. It's paired with an 8-speed automatic transmission and comes with either front-wheel drive or all-wheel drive. This engine belongs to the Volvo Drive-E series, which is well - known for its high efficiency and environmental friendliness, meeting the Euro 6 emission standards.
